Job Description:

The Manager, Sales Development is responsible for working with the Director, Sales Development to coach and develop the team of inbound Sales Development Representatives (SDR). The Manager, Sales Development is responsible for driving new business pipeline growth required to achieve new business company bookings targets. This role is crucial for driving growth and achieving company targets by overseeing key activities such as coaching, optimizing sales processes, and ensuring the SDRs are performing at their best.

  • Lead, mentor, and coach a team of inbound SDRs to meet and exceed lead generation and pipeline development targets.
  • Monitor reverse funnel metrics to ensure 3-4x pipeline coverage
  • Monitor no show reports to ensure meeting is rescheduled
  • Monitor stall and unqualified meetings to ensure appropriate action is taken
  • Ensuring effective lead qualification and nurturing
  • Coach on objection handling to refine cold calling skillset
  • Monitor lead queues to ensure appropriate cadence execution of 8 touch
  • Monitor lead queues to ensure speed to lead
  • Collaborate with marketing teams on MGL to SAL conversion
  • Collaborate with marketing teams on successful campaign execution
  • Monitor key performance metrics, analyze data, and provide regular performance reports to SDR Director.
  • Conduct inbound team meetings, inbound performance reviews, and one-on-one coaching sessions.
  • Train inbound new hire SDR
  • Develop SDR skillset on the team to build a strong bench for the SDR outbound program and eventually NextGen field sales
  • Perform other duties that support the overall objective of the position.
